How to delete alternating BLANK rows in .xls file all @ once?
Assuming you have data in between those blank rows:
Select a column. Press Ctrl+G to bring up the goto dialogue. Click
'Special', then select blanks. Ok out.
Now, with those cells selected, press Ctrl+minus sybol. Select the option to
delete entire row. Ok out.
